What are cumulonimbus clouds?
Mazyrski [523]

Explanation:

Cumulonimbus clouds are a type of cumulus cloud associated with thunder storms and heavy precipitation. They are also a variation of nimbus or precipitation bearing clouds. They are formed beneath 20,000 ft. and are relatively close to the ground. ... These clouds often produce lightning in their heart.
